[QUOTE="winnie_992, post: 2363471, member: 1839"] I think we need to recruit an established half so we don't go through a similar predicament the roosters went through when Fittler retired. Wallace is, well Wallace he cannot be relied on to be leading the team around, he's solid at best but no match winner. If Hunt or Norman are to be brought in then we need to punt Wallace and recruit an established half to bring either Hunt or Norman along. A combo of Wallace/ Hunt or Norman just doesnt cut it for me. A halves combo of Hunt and Norman is just too inexperienced, Norman has minimal experience and Hunt has been playing out of position in the NRL. I havnt seen enough from either player to say they will be superstars and to throw them in the NRL without an established partner would just be suicide. With the young and talented team we have if we don't recruit a quality half that talent could be wasted and the chance to win a premiership may be a long way off (after we win this year of course icon_thumbs_u ) [/QUOTE]
